TBILISI. Aug 2 (Interfax) - Representatives of Georgia and the breakaway region of Abkhazia are due to meet in Tbilisi on Thursday to consider guarantees of security and of the non-resumption of Georgian- Abkhaz hostilities, Georgian State Minister Giorgi Khaindrava told reporters on Tuesday.
The meeting was scheduled to be held several days ago, but Abkhazia refused to take part, accusing Georgia of failing to keep its promise to release humanitarian relief that was aboard a Turkish ship seized by Georgian coastguards off Abkhaz shores on July 3. The relief was delivered to Abkhazia on Monday with the intervention of UN officials.
